Evans Middle School Principal Darla Jackson Named MISD Director of Human Resources

McKinney, Texas – Longtime McKinney ISD educator and principal of Evans Middle School Darla Jackson has been named director of human resources for MISD. Jackson brings 20 years in education to her new position, with nine years of experience as a campus administrator and the past six years spent as the principal of Evans Middle School.

Jackson began her career in 1997 in Arlington ISD, then stepped away from the classroom for several years to stay home with her children. Her eventual return to education brought her to MISD and Eddins Elementary, where she served as a fourth grade teacher. When Cockrill Middle School opened in 2008, Jackson made the move to secondary education and served as Cockrill’s ELAR department chair and later as the instructional coach.

In 2013, Jackson moved into campus administration, serving first as the assistant principal at Evans Middle School and then as the assistant principal at McNeil Elementary School. She returned to Evans in 2016 when she was chosen as the school’s new principal. During Jackson’s tenure at Evans, the school has earned recognition as an AVID Site of Distinction and as one of N2 Learning’s Schools Transforming Learning. In 2021, Jackson was named Administrator of the Year by the Texas School Counselor Association.

“I am grateful for the opportunity and very excited to join the Human Resources Department for MISD,” Jackson said. “I look forward to supporting our principals and educators in our journey to continue providing an exemplary educational experience for all our students in McKinney. It has been an honor serving as Evans’ principal, and I will bring with me the knowledge I gained from working with that wonderful community.”

Jackson holds a bachelor’s degree in interdisciplinary studies (early childhood) from Texas Wesleyan University and a master’s degree in educational administration from Lamar University.
